I was filling up some applications for some official stuff and there was a column which said
Father's name :-
Husband's name (if applicable) ;-
I , as per habit, cut off the husband part and wrote my father's name and carried on with other sections of the form.
In a few seconds it struck me that I do have a husband now and realised I might have to re-do this page and got a little miffed about the re-work.
And in that moment I realised whats this whole thing about a woman having to write father's or husband's name? What does it warranty?
So a mother or a wife has no bearing in anything official? Why doesn't a form ever ask for their names? They do not have an identity or presence strong enough in your lives to be required on a form?
Sometimes I wonder why do I hold on to things like this? Why cant I just accept that it is after all a man's world and do whats required without gumption?
Well, if I could do that..it would not be me
